Which combination of statements about magnetic field lines is correct?
A
Magnetic field lines can cross each other; they can form closed loops in empty space.
B
Magnetic field lines can never cross each other; they can form closed loops if they enclose a current.
C
Magnetic field lines indicate the strength of the magnetic field; they can never form closed loops.
D
Magnetic field lines are always confined within a magnet; they can cross at certain points.
Correct Answer
Option B
Detailed Explanation
Magnetic field lines can never cross each other because it would create ambiguity in direction. They can form closed loops only when they enclose a region with current, as stated in the context.
